Output 70861391c4775c57886935d2fdc41e1bd7c6e85f0b81480f179651e6c31d3f45:21

value
23103
script pubkey
OP_0 OP_PUSHBYTES_20 039e6eb686685d29a8cdf3242bc5f738004d830d
address
bc1qqw0xad5xdpwjn2xd7vjzh30h8qqymqcd33au8t
transaction
70861391c4775c57886935d2fdc41e1bd7c6e85f0b81480f179651e6c31d3f45
confirmations
45382
spent
true